Digital Exterior Mirror Product Landscape
Digital exterior mirrors offer significant advantages over traditional mirrors, including enhanced visibility in adverse weather conditions, improved aerodynamics, reduced wind noise, and integration with advanced driver-assistance systems. Innovations include the use of high-resolution cameras, advanced image processing algorithms, and intuitive display systems. These advancements improve visibility, particularly at night and in bad weather, increasing overall road safety. The incorporation of features like blind-spot detection and lane-keeping assist further enhances the safety profile of vehicles equipped with digital exterior mirrors.
Key Drivers, Barriers & Challenges in Digital Exterior Mirror
Key Drivers:
- Stringent safety regulations mandating improved vehicle visibility.
- Growing demand for enhanced driver assistance systems (ADAS).
- Technological advancements in camera and display technologies.
Key Challenges and Restraints:
- High initial cost of implementation compared to traditional mirrors.
- Potential reliability concerns and cybersecurity vulnerabilities.
- Regulatory hurdles and standardization challenges across different regions.
- Supply chain disruptions impacting the availability of key components.
